Corinthians hand 17-year-old Júlia Faria her first professional deal

Article image:Corinthians hand 17-year-old Júlia Faria her first professional deal

Corinthians have handed 17-year-old midfielder Júlia Faria her first professional contract. According to Meu Timao, the 2008-born talent completed the paperwork on Monday.

Faria joined the club in October 2023, linking up with the under-17s. Early last year she renewed her deal until the end of 2027.

In August she lifted the Brasileiro Feminino at under-17 level. She also featured for Brazil at the last Under-17 World Cup, starting all seven matches.

On social media, she expressed delight at the milestone, thanking God, her family and everyone who has supported her. She described representing Corinthians as an honour and said she is pursuing new goals and dreams.

She is not the first player promoted in 2026. Goalkeeper Ana Morganti and right-back Rafa Rocha also moved into the senior squad earlier this year, and both were named in the squad for the Supercopa, where Corinthians lost on penalties to Palmeiras last Saturday.
